Warning Signs You Need Supply Line Break Water Removal in Pueblo of Jemez, NM

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and health risks. Be aware of these common signs that show you need supply line break water removal: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ent, unpleasant odor in your home or business, it may be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ore it, call us today to investigate and fix the issue before it gets worse.

Warped or Discolored Flooring

If your flooring is warped or discolored, it may be a sign of water damage. Don’t delay, call us to assess and repair the damage before it spreads.

Visible Water Stains or Leaks

If you notice visible water stains or leaks in your ceiling, walls, or floors, it’s a clear sign that you need supply line break water removal. Call us today to contain the damage and prevent further water damage.

Supply Line Break Water Removal Cost in Pueblo of Jemez, NM

The cost of supply line break water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Pueblo of Jemez, NM.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Response $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and time of day.
Drying and Cleaning $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ials affected, and complexity of the job.
Restoration and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of materials affected, and complexity of the job.

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ges, and the final cost will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and will work with you to create a customized plan that fits your budget and needs.
